Julie A. Robichaud is a scholar working on Neurology, Biomedical Engineering and Physical Therapy, Sports Therapy and Rehabilitation. According to data from OpenAlex, Julie A. Robichaud has authored 21 papers receiving a total of 1.2k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 15 papers in Neurology, 10 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 5 papers in Physical Therapy, Sports Therapy and Rehabilitation. Recurrent topics in Julie A. Robichaud’s work include Parkinson's Disease Mechanisms and Treatments (14 papers), Neurological disorders and treatments (10 papers) and Muscle activation and electromyography studies (10 papers). Julie A. Robichaud is often cited by papers focused on Parkinson's Disease Mechanisms and Treatments (14 papers), Neurological disorders and treatments (10 papers) and Muscle activation and electromyography studies (10 papers). Julie A. Robichaud collaborates with scholars based in United States. Julie A. Robichaud's co-authors include Daniel M. Corcos, Cynthia L. Comella, David E. Vaillancourt, Cynthia Poon and Wendy M. Kohrt and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Neurophysiology, Experimental Brain Research and Movement Disorders.
